Skip to main content
Quick Tip

Get single column's value from the first result

You can use value() method to get single column's value from the first result of a query.

// Instead of
Integration::where('name', 'foo')->first()->active;
 
// You can use
Integration::where('name', 'foo')->value('active');
 
// or this to throw an exception if no records found
Integration::where('name', 'foo')->valueOrFail('active')';

Tip given by @justsanjit

Enjoyed This Tip?

Get access to all premium tutorials, video and text courses, and exclusive Laravel resources. Join our community of 10,000+ developers.

Recent Courses on Laravel Daily

Laravel 13 Starter Kit Teams and Customizations

10 lessons
33 min

Roles and Permissions in Laravel 13

14 lessons
57 min

Laravel 13 Eloquent: Expert Level

41 lessons
1 h 34 min